VINYL ONLY! For the first release the Swiss Label has chosen a timeless Deep House track from Cologne resident and Stadtgruen founder Martin Donath. >Veranda< pleases with dubby chords, shuffled hi-hats and wonderful pads. Dubbyman – Spanish Deep House pioneer and head of the fantastic label Deep Explorer Music contributes with an incredible remix here and increases the focus on the soft and moody pads. The result is pure ear candy and we cant wait to hear this tune at the beach. Two extremely strong tracks with a fantastically casual attitude and a promising beginning for Waehlscheibe. Both tracks mastered by Above Smoke at the Hole of dub studio.

Yore returns with yet another Deep Master Piece. Javier Alvarez, a Madrid-based producer and proprietor (along with his younger brother Dubbyman) of the underground label Deep Explorer Music, brings his relaxed Above Smoke sound to the Yore imprint.
In the first of four warm and atmospheric mood pieces, “Awfully” drapes dense synthetic winds over a deliciously grooving, bass-prodded deep house pulse. “Get Down” does exactly that with five funky minutes of Rhodes chords, disco hi-hats, and synth swirls; a percolating bass line lends the track a propulsive charge, while crowd voices give the cut a party vibe. On the B side’s “The Fix” Javier scatters chopped fragments of the spoken line, I’ve got a lot of shit to say and I can’t say it all in one day, I can’t say it all on one piece of tape, over a funk-house groove, after which Dubbyman offers variations on the theme in his remix of the track;
Dubbyman’s version digs deeper into the cut’s bass science and warms the tune’s slinky pulse with hand percussion and claps.
Old-school in its embrace of classic house sounds, Above Smoke’s EP is tailor-made for those who like their material laid-back, groove-centered, and funky.

Minuendo Recordings presents a new various artist vinyl Deep Wars (MND 14) following their line with one of the most acclaimed producers of the moment in the international deep house and techno sounds, Patrice Scott, along with the Spanish producers Above Smoke, Ordell and Ernie.
Patrice Scott, the Detroit artist and owner of Sistrum label presents “Nuonce” that is called to be a break dance floor in the coming months.
Patrice follows the characteristic Sistrum sound. Melody, synth and atmosphere.
100% Detroit sound from the motorcity to Minuendo.
“Save us” is deep house in pure state, composed by one of the most interesting artist of the moment, Above Smoke, Dubbyman’s right hand in Deep Explorer.
We can’t miss Ordell, our revelation artist in the previous album Grand Deep Auto (Mnd13).
With his “Hardface” he betters himself and sets a very high stardard. An amazing mix of synths, vocal, instruments and guitar by the hand of Amado. This is black music.
Ernie introduce in this album “Tsunamisadolight“, a fully ultra deep track.
Samples and keyboards which made a compendium of soft circular melodies, depth, tension with a touch of groove.
